Grand National winning trainer Martin Brassil struck at Wexford today with heavily supported 11/8 favourite I Will Follow who won the Monart Handicap Hurdle under jockey Paul Townend.

The son of Bonbon Rose was backed from 9/4 on track to 11/8 ‘jolly’ and in the race, went clear of his rivals approaching the final flight and in the end won snugly by three and three parts of a length from Lockeen Girl

I Will Follow was an eye-catcher when second, from an initial rating of 88, on his handicap hurdle debut at Roscommon earlier this month and following today’s win, Brassil remarked “he had three runs in the winter and I thought he'd handle soft ground but he didn't.

“It was a pleasant surprise in Roscommon that he handled the better ground and I'm glad he has progressed from there. I don't know how good he is but he has won now and it is a stepping stone to somewhere else.

“He stays well, jumps well and is a summer easy ground horse rather than a winter heavy ground horse. He likes a nice level track and there might be a race for him in Listowel in September.”
